Output 50aa82594eaef2de0f66e58ea6830a8f43c044bc53bb6d2bcce514025739476d:0

value
32394760
script pubkey
OP_HASH160 OP_PUSHBYTES_20 725d76684c546a8ae54e6a741dadb801c1ce9839 OP_EQUAL
address
MJKsEBvmYDkwcf9PtaAM6jZ3YongqUuR3m
transaction
50aa82594eaef2de0f66e58ea6830a8f43c044bc53bb6d2bcce514025739476d
spent
true